** Vue3+TS 实战应用 —— 实现 组件调用 Computed 返回值 自动提示【分页应用】**
训练技能点:
type 对象类型技巧性应用
作业描述:
阅读并上机测试下面代码【React 技术栈的同学可以掌握思路即可】,自己定义出 Pager 类型,基础属性有 pageNum【当前第几页】, pageSize【每一页的最大记录数】 ,total 【总记录数】。要求实现如下:
- 保证没有编译错误 2. 保证组件调用 pager 变量 时 能自动提示属性
// 1. 多属性对象可以赋值给少属性对象
type TypStu = { username: string,age:number }
let liPing = { username: "wangwu", age: 23,address:"beijing" }
let zhangSan: TypStu = liPing
// 2 获取异步分页数据代码片段
type Pager={
}
let pager:Pager = computed(() => {
return ......
})